Mrs. Harrison Cork Dead.
The Clarksburg Telegram., January 17, 1902, page 4
Mrs. Sarah Cork, widow of the late Harrison Cork, died at 5:30 o’clock Thursday afternoon of kidney trouble, after two months’ illness.
Funeral services will be held Saturday afternoon at the residence and interment will be in the I. O. O. F. cemetery. Rev. S. K. Arbuthnot will officiate.
Mrs. Cork’s maiden name was Sarah Hull.
She was 64 years of age.
One son, Ellisworth Cork, survives her.
Mr. Cork preceded her to the grave by only a few months.
